Stoan is a rough, textured grunge font, based on the popular Spaza. Its characters are irregular and funky, with edges that disappear into the distance.

A graffiti-esque "tag" font designed to fit into thin and confined spaces. Edifice Wrecks is an OpenType font with several automatic ligatures built in.
The Lotus font consists of Art Nouveau initials ornamented with graceful flowers. Lotus is an attractive choice for posters and brochures relating to horticultural activities.
Phyllis was designed by Heinrich Wieynck in 1904. The Phyllis font has a suite of alternative initials that provide a flourish to an otherwise modest script.
